ABSTRACT
More than 277 different forms of cancer diseases are included in the term "cancer" in its broadest sense. Different cancer stages have been identified by researchers, suggesting that a number of gene alterations are involved in the aetiology of cancer. The aberrant cell proliferation caused by certain gene mutations. A crucial role in the acceleration of cell proliferation is played by genetic diseases brought on by heredity or hereditary factors. Additional knowledge has been gathered that can be helpful for early diagnosis and appropriate treatment with the use of technical advancements in bioinformatics and molecular approaches.The negative effects of medications on cancer patients can be anticipated and in some cases managed. Recent molecular genetic investigations have identified the mechanisms of carcinogenesis. These research' findings enhanced our knowledge of how genetic abnormalities contribute to the development of cancer. Our goal in this work was to review cancer's molecular components
